Subiaco has moved swiftly to replace the five Lions drafted to the AFL in the national and rookie draft, with Drew Rohde signing on to play for Subiaco in 2018.
Rohde spent the 2017 season playing in the Central Midlands Coastal Football League, helping Jurien Bay to win the premiership playing alongside returning Lion, Rhys Waters. Rohde played 14 games and kicked 19 goals for Jurien Bay being named one of the best players in the CMCFL Grand Final.
